We join with you in earnest prayer, lifting up your heart’s cry to break free from the chains of bad habits that hinder your walk with Christ and your productivity in His kingdom. It is beautiful to see you seeking the Lord’s strength to overcome these struggles, and we commend you for turning to Him in surrender, acknowledging that true change only comes through His power.

The apostle Paul reminds us in Romans 7:15-25 of the internal battle we face between our flesh and the Spirit: *"For I don’t know what I am doing. For I don’t practice what I desire to do; but what I hate, that I do... I find then the law, that, to me, while I desire to do good, evil is present... What a wretched man I am! Who will deliver me out of the body of this death? I thank God through Jesus Christ, our Lord!"* Your struggle is not unique—even Paul faced this tension—but the victory is found in Christ alone. He is the One who breaks the power of sin and sets us free to walk in obedience.

We also recall the words of 1 Corinthians 10:13: *"No temptation has taken you except what is common to man. God is faithful, who will not allow you to be tempted above what you are able, but will with the temptation also make the way of escape, that you may be able to endure."* The Lord does not leave you powerless. He provides a way out, and by His grace, you can resist and replace these habits with godly disciplines.

Let us also consider Ephesians 4:22-24, which calls us to *"put away, as concerning your former way of life, the old man, that grows corrupt after the lusts of deceit; and that you be renewed in the spirit of your mind, and put on the new man, who in the likeness of God has been created in righteousness and holiness of truth."* This is not just about stopping bad habits—it is about being transformed by the renewing of your mind through God’s Word and the Holy Spirit’s work in you.
